Bagikan melalui


ICDBurn::Metode GetRecorderDriveLetter (shobjidl.h)

Mendapatkan huruf kandar kandar CD yang telah ditandai sebagai write-enabled.

Sintaks

HRESULT GetRecorderDriveLetter(
  [out] LPWSTR pszDrive,
  [in]  UINT   cch
);

Parameter

[out] pszDrive

Jenis: LPWSTR

Penunjuk ke string yang berisi huruf drive, misalnya "F:".

[in] cch

Jenis: UINT

Ukuran string, dalam karakter, ditujukkan oleh pszDrive. Nilai ini biasanya akan menjadi 4. Nilai yang lebih besar dari 4 diizinkan, tetapi karakter tambahan akan diabaikan oleh metode ini. Nilai kurang dari 4 akan menghasilkan kesalahan E_INVALIDARG.

Nilai kembali

Jenis: HRESULT

Jika metode ini berhasil, metode akan mengembalikan S_OK. Jika tidak, kode kesalahan HRESULT akan dikembalikan.

Keterangan

Drive yang penetapan hurufnya dikembalikan oleh metode ini adalah drive yang memiliki opsi Aktifkan penulisan cd pada drive ini dipilih. Opsi ini ditemukan pada lembar properti drive. Hanya satu kandar pada sistem yang dapat memilih opsi ini.

Jika drive CD yang dapat direkam ada tetapi opsi tersebut telah dibatalkan pilihannya, metode akan mengembalikan kode kesalahan.

Persyaratan

Persyaratan Nilai
Klien minimum yang didukung Windows XP [hanya aplikasi desktop]
Server minimum yang didukung Windows Server 2003 [hanya aplikasi desktop]
Target Platform Windows
Header shobjidl.h
DLL Shell32.dll